On tap at the brewery. Aroma is hop forward with nice notes of goose, passion fruit, tropical citrus and tangerine. Lighter notes of grapefruit and dank, resin notes. Light cracker malt and alcohol notes. Hints of rye. Pours a hazy, murky, golden straw color with a medium sized, thick, pillowy white head that recedes slowly to a small film that lingers. Moderate lacing and small legs. Flavor is somewhat sweet with light cracker malt notes and hints of rye. Moderately strong bitterness and light alcohol notes. Lots of gooseberry, passion fruit and tropical citrus. Lighter notes of grapefruit, peach and dank resin notes. Mouthfeel is medium bodied with medium carbonation. Low astringency and low alcohol warmth. Overall, a really solid IPA. Really nice nelson notes with some balanced cracker malt notes and a touch of rye. Fairly bright and fruity with a touch of dank resin to balance it out.
